Output 391b857645dfa783ccd9c51316f0b965583fd378c04a9be1146ca52f2181107d:1

value
46943879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e393afeae4d656cbe0837cc9585ce334b20d398 OP_EQUAL
address
MKQZw3PtRTmFxXHAATbH1FqRyFPEc9swSL
transaction
391b857645dfa783ccd9c51316f0b965583fd378c04a9be1146ca52f2181107d
spent
true